Terraced three-bay two-storey former house, built c. 1840, having render shopfront to front (north-east). Now in use as retail unit. Pitched artificial slate roof with rendered chimneystacks, eaves course and aluminium rainwater goods with cast-iron downpipes. Rendered walls with plinth, having render quoins and recent wrought-iron street lamp attached to first floor of front elevation. Square-headed window openings with raised render reveals and tooled stone sills to first floor, having uPVC casement windows. Render shopfront comprising moulded architrave and frieze with raised lettering surmounted by moulded cornice. Camber-headed window openings having moulded render sills and recent timber-framed multiple-pane display windows. Camber-headed door opening having double-leaf timber battened doors surmounted by single-pane fanlight. Located fronting directly onto street.
